Branden Steineckert




(born April 21, 1978), is the current drummer for the punk rock band Rancid. He was previously the drummer of The Used, but was kicked out of the band in August 2006.

Branden was born in Pocatello, Idaho, U.S. and was raised in a Mormon family which moved more than twenty times during his youth. When Branden was 11 years old, his father, Neil Steineckert, committed suicide, after which he picked up skateboarding as a way to release himself from his problems.

At the age of 16, Branden decided to learn how to play the drums because his late father had played drums at around his age. He was a founding member of Strange Itch, a band that would later become The Used, and would go on to achieve success, earning a platinum album.

On November 3, 2006, it was announced that Branden would be playing drums for Rancid until the end of their tour. He replaced their drummer of 15 years, Brett Reed. On the tour, Rancid members stated that Branden would be a permanent addition to the band (also noted on the official Used fansite). It has been confirmed that Branden will also be present on the band's upcoming seventh studio album,[1] despite the fact that it has been in the works since 2005, only a year before he joined.[2]
